El Cajon Retired Senior Volunteer Patrol (RSVP) Mission Statement
The Retired Senior Volunteer Patrol Program of the El Cajon Police Department is committed to the recruitment, development and retention of talented volunteers who are to practice their skills in a work environment which encourages participation in meaningful community service programs.
The Retired Senior Volunteer Patrol Program personnel will strive to enhance crime prevention efforts throughout the City of El Cajon by supporting community services and promoting safety through programs of crime prevention and education.
RSVP assists the El Cajon Police Department by:
- Enforcing handicapped parking regulations
- Conduction vacation home security checks
- Performing traffic control
- Patrolling business districts, parking lots and school zones
- Calling or visiting homebound seniors as part of the YANA Program
- Documenting graffiti sighting by completing Observation Reports
- Making personal contact with business owners, patrons, residents and visitors
- Performing other additional duties.
Participation in the program requires:
- A minimum of one six-hour shift per week
- Must be of good moral character
- A minimum participation commitment of one year
- Attendance at monthly training meetings
- Participation in a two-week academy
- Must be a U.S. citizen
- Must possess medical and automobile insurance
- Participation in periodic refresher training
- Physical ability to perform all patrol related duties
- Possess a valid California Driver’s License
- Compliance with all City of El Cajon, El Cajon Police Department and Retired Senior Volunteer Patrol rules and regulations
- Applicants must be 55 years old or over
